How To Fix NJIT_MSG_BP067 - Production Version & does not exist


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: NJIT_MSG_BP -

  • Message number: 067

  • Message text: Production Version & does not exist

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message NJIT_MSG_BP067 - Production Version & does not exist ?

    The SAP error message NJIT_MSG_BP067 indicates that a production version for a specific material does not exist in the system. This error typically arises in the context of production planning and execution when the system is unable to find a valid production version for the material being processed.

    Cause:

    1. Missing Production Version: The most common cause is that the production version for the specified material has not been created or is not active.
    2. Incorrect Material Number: The material number being referenced may be incorrect or may not exist in the system.
    3. Plant-Specific Issues: The production version may exist for a different plant, and the system is looking for it in the wrong plant.
    4. Data Inconsistencies: There may be inconsistencies in the master data, such as missing or incorrect entries in the material master or BOM (Bill of Materials).

    Solution:

    1. Check Production Version:

      • Go to the material master (transaction code MM03) and check if the production version exists for the specified material and plant.
      • If it does not exist, you will need to create a new production version using transaction code C223 (for creating production versions).
    2. Create Production Version:

      • If the production version is missing, create it by specifying the relevant details such as the material, plant, BOM, and routing.
      • Ensure that the production version is active and correctly linked to the material.
    3. Verify Material Number:

      • Double-check the material number being used in the transaction to ensure it is correct and exists in the system.
    4. Check Plant Assignment:

      • Ensure that the production version is assigned to the correct plant. If the production version exists for a different plant, you may need to create a new version for the required plant.
    5. Review BOM and Routing:

      • Ensure that the BOM and routing associated with the production version are correctly maintained and active.
    6. Consult Documentation:

      • If you are unsure about the steps or need further assistance, refer to SAP documentation or consult with your SAP support team.

    Related Information:

    • Transaction Codes:

      • MM03: Display Material Master
      • C223: Create Production Version
      • CS03: Display BOM
      • CA03: Display Routing
    • Master Data Maintenance: Ensure that all relevant master data (material master, BOM, routing) is correctly maintained and up to date.

    • SAP Notes: Check for any relevant SAP Notes that may address specific issues related to production versions or provide additional troubleshooting steps.
